Biography of Simon Cowell
Early Life and Background
Simon Phillip Cowell was born on October 7, 1959, in London, England. He grew up in a family with a strong connection to the entertainment industry. His father, Eric Cowell, was an architect who later became a music industry executive, while his mother, Julie Beresford, was a dancer. This early exposure to the arts played a significant role in shaping Cowell's career trajectory.

Music Industry Beginnings
Cowell began his career in the music industry in the 1980s, working for his father's label, EMI. He later co-founded BMG Records, where he discovered and nurtured the careers of artists like the Spice Girls and Westlife. His ability to identify talent and produce successful albums established him as a key player in the music world.
Television Success
Cowell's transition to television began with "Pop Idol" in the UK, which later became the global phenomenon "American Idol." His sharp critiques and no-nonsense approach made him a fan favorite, leading to his involvement in other successful franchises like "The X Factor" and "Britain's Got Talent."
Health Challenges
In recent years, Simon Cowell has faced several health challenges that have captured public attention. In 2021, he underwent spinal surgery after suffering a fall at his home. The injury affected his mobility and required extensive rehabilitation, prompting concerns about his long-term health.
